Based on the hit 1994 Walt Disney animated film of the same name, The Lion King musical is set in the African Pridelands and tells the coming of age story of lion cub Simba. Technical personnel The award-winning musical The Lion King is directed by Julie Taymor who in 1998 made Broadway history, being the first woman to win Best Direction of a Musical. Set against the majesty of the Serengeti Plains and to the evocative rhythms of Africa, Disney's The Lion King musical is unlike anything ever before seen in musical theatre, and will redefine your expectations of what theatre can be.

Important show and performance information for the Lion King musical, London Duration of the performance lasts approximately 2 hours and 30 minutes and includes one interval. Director and designer Julie Taymor crafts a colourful, imaginative and highly creative world that brings the flora, fauna and animals of Africa to live, set against a timeless score by Elton John and Tim Rice, with additional songs by Lebo M, Julie Taymor, Mark Mancina and Hans Zimmer. The Lion King began previews in the West End on 24th September 1999, with an official opening on 19th October 1999.
